Samar and Ankit start to do a piece of work. Samar can complete the piece of work in β€˜D’ days. If Ankit can complete 25% of the same work in 5D/4 days, then find the ratio of efficiency of Ankit to that of Samar.
Anonymous Quiz
14%
(a) 2 : 5
22%
(b) 1 : 2
61%
(c) 1 : 5
3%
(d) 2 : 7
πŸ‘†Ans. C
Explanation:

Let the total work be w units.

Total time taken by Samar to complete the work = D days

Now, Ankit does 0.25w units of work in 1.25D days.

Hence, Ankit will take 5D days to complete the total w units of work.

Efficiency of Samar = 1/D

Efficiency of Ankit = 1/5D

Hence, the required ratio of efficiency of Ankit to that of Samar = 1/5D : 1/D = 1 : 5

Mr. Suresh owns a 5 metre Γ— 4 metre coffee shop. He plans to tile the rectangular floor of this shop with grey-coloured square tiles. Each side of the tile measures 20 cm. What must be the total cost of fitting the tiles, if they cost Rs. 40 per piece?
Anonymous Quiz
1%
(a) Rs. 12,000
24%
(b) Rs. 16,000
21%
(c) Rs. 24,000
54%
(d) Rs. 20,000
❀1
πŸ‘†Ans. D
Explanation:

Area of coffee shop = 5 metre Γ— 4 metre = 20 square metres

Area of one tile = 0.2 metres Γ— 0.2 metre = 0.04 square metres

Number of tiles required = Area of rectangular region / Area of one square tile = 20 square metres / 0.04 square metres = 500

Therefore, total cost of fitting the tiles = number of tiles Γ— cost of fitting 1 tile = 500 Γ— 40 = Rs. 20,000

How many numbers with distinct digits are there, such that the product of digits of each number is 27?
Anonymous Quiz
8%
(a) 7
24%
(b) 9
63%
(c) 8
5%
(d) 6
πŸ‘2
πŸ‘†Ans. C
Explanation:

Two digit numbers: The two digits can be 3 and 9: Two possibilities - 39 and 93.

Three-digit numbers: The three digits can be 1, 3 and 9, i.e. 3! or 6 possibilities - 139, 193, 319, 391, 913, 931. We cannot have three digits as (3, 3, 3) as the digits have to be distinct.

Also, we cannot have numbers with 4 digits or more without repeating the digits. So, there are a total of 8 such numbers.

An encrypted code consists of two distinct English alphabets followed by two distinct numbers from 1 to 9. For example, YZ25 is an encrypted code. How many such distinct codes are possible?
Anonymous Quiz
4%
(a) 71950
24%
(b) 61580
27%
(c) 41080
45%
(d) 46800
❀3πŸ‘1
πŸ‘†Ans. D
Explanation:

Here, first two positions are fixed for alphabets and the last two for numbers.

Let encrypted code be a1 a2 b1 b2. Where a1, a2 are English alphabets, and b1, b2 are numbers.

There are 26 English alphabets and we have to choose 2 distinct alphabets. First alphabet can be selected in 26 ways and second alphabet can be chosen in 25 ways.

Out of 9 digits (1 to 9), first digit can be selected in 9 ways and second digit can be selected in 8 ways. Thus, the number of possible distinct codes = 26 Γ— 25 Γ— 9 Γ— 8 = 46800
